So here is the story. I am in Athens, Georgia this week doing what I do. I am rebuilding 3 old power supplies we built in the early to mid 80's. I happen to look up in the logic section and notice 3 strange looking red led's. Upon closer inspection, they bear a striking resemblance to the LED seen in the MOM phots on the ref CD. I can't get a really good look at MOM lamp, but from what I can see, it is dead nuts on. This lamp is actually incandescent, and not an LED. It's an odd little thing to say the least. The wires are not soldered to it, instead they plug in. The bezel is actually black, and not chrome. It also has a spring clamp to hold it in place, and it is a 28VDC lamp. I have 9 of the red ones in my tool bag now, and can get up to 12 more clear ones. Have a look and tell me what you think. I may be barking up the wrong tree here, but its worth a shot.
